SQL INSERT INTO SELECT 语句
全部标签文章目录前言一、for循环1.1语法1.2for语句的循环控制变量1.3一些for循环的变种二、do...while()循环2.1do语句的语法2.2do...while循环中的break和continue2.3练习1**-计算n的阶乘**2.-**在一个有序数组中查找具体的某个数字n**==二分查找算法;折半查找算法(前提,有序)==3.-**编写代码,演示多个字符从两端移动,向中间汇聚4.-**编写代码实现,模拟用户登录情景,并且只能登录三次(只允许输入三次密码,如果密码正确则提示登录成功,如果三次均输入错误,则退出程序。)**5.-**两个字符串的比较**前言C语言:结构化的程序设计语言
【示例】逗号运算符publicclassTest{publicstaticvoidmain(String[]args){for(inti=1,j=i+10;i输出:i=1 j=11 i=2 j=4 i=3 j=6 i=4 j=8无论在初始化还是在步进部分,语句都是顺序执行的。尽管初始化部分可设置任意数量的定义,但都属于同一类型。约定:只在for语句的控制表达式中写入与循环变量初始化,条件判断和迭代因子相关的表达式。初始化部分、条件判断部分和迭代因子可以为空语句,但必须以“;”分开,如示例所示。【示例】无限循环publicclassTest{publicstaticvoidmain(
当我执行此代码时,只有print("itisgreaterthanzero")被执行,但我有两种情况是正确的,我尝试使用fallthrough关键字,但它会执行下一个caseblock,即使它为false,无论如何,这又引出了另一个问题,什么时候应该使用fallthrough关键字?如果我想强制执行下一个block,为什么不将代码插入到fallthrough所在的同一block中?有没有什么方法可以让下面的示例打印所有计算结果为真的情况并仍然排除所有计算结果为假的情况?letnumber=1switchnumber{case_wherenumber>0:print("itisgreat
我正在尝试测试一个函数是否打印出一些东西。我如何使用XCTests做到这一点?如果这是可能的,是否有事实理由去做和不去做?谢谢! 最佳答案 我不知道有什么方法可以测试print语句,但我认为这无关紧要。print语句的输出与您的应用实际执行的操作无关。您应该测试您的应用更改了哪些数据,它向用户显示了什么,等等。 关于ios-如何使用XCTests测试打印语句?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.
一、判断的定义:如果条件满足,才能做某件事情,如果条件不满足,就做另外一件事情,或者什么也不做二、if语句语法结构标准if条件语句的语法缩进:python代码的层级关系缩进一般加4个空格if语句语法结构如果表达式的值非0或者为布尔值True,则代码组if_suite被执行;否则就去执行else_suite代码组是一个python术语,它由一条或多条语句组成,表示一个子代码块空类型判断验证各类型空的判断input='判断""的结果:';if"":#Trueprint(input,"True")else:print(input,"False")input="判断[]的结果:";if[]:#Fals
我有一个正在执行的“iflet”语句,尽管“let”部分为零。ifletleftInc:Double?=self.analysis.inputs[self.btnLeftIncisor.dictionaryKey!]!{println(leftInc)letvalueString:String=formatter.stringFromNumber(NSNumber(double:leftInc!))!self.leftIncisorTextField?.text=valueStringself.btnLeftIncisor.associatedLabel?.text=valueStri
循环语句循环的概念重复的执行一段代码,避免死循环,提高效率(时间复杂度-关注和空间复杂度-不关注)循环包含三大语句:while语句、dowhile语句、for语句循环的三要素:初始值(初始的变量)迭代量(基于初始的改变)条件(基于初始的判断)while语句while(条件表达式(返回true和false)){ 执行的代码}var初始值变量=值while(条件){ 迭代量 执行的代码}示例(循环打印1-10)vari=1while(i console.log(i) i++}示例(循环打印1加到100)// 1加到100varnumber=0varsum=0while(number n
一、循环 概念:重复执行一段代码(while、dowhile、for) 注:1)、避免死循环 2)、提高效率(减少时间复杂度) 循环三要素:初始值、迭代量、条件1、while(条件表达式返回true或false){ 执行代码 } var初始值变量=值 while(条件){ 迭代量 执行代码 }自旋:while(true)生成一万个订单编号,不能重复,生成编号的代码无限去生成,直到有一万个不重复的订单编码才出去2、dowhile(对应的while唯一的区别是先做,后判断,意味着最少走一次)while与dowhile的区
请看下面的switch语句。我正在寻找一种更快捷的方法来执行测试;像这样的东西:caselet.b(other)where.x=other//Thisdoesnotcompile这可能吗?enumMyEnum{caseacaseb(MyOtherEnum)}enumMyOtherEnum{casexcasey}funccheck(value:MyEnum){switchvalue{caselet.b(other):ifcase.x=other{print("Gotit!")}default:break}} 最佳答案 如果您只对案例M
ifletpopupButton=result?.controlas?NSPopUpButto{ifpopupButton.numberOfItems我想避免双重嵌套if。ifletpopupButton=result?.controlas?NSPopUpButton&&popupButton.numberOfItems但如果我这样做,我会收到unresolvedidentifier编译器错误。有什么办法可以在一行中实现这个条件吗?或者因为我使用的是可选绑定(bind),我是否被迫在此处创建嵌套的if? 最佳答案 你可以这样做:if